static void adf_dev_restore(struct adf_accel_dev *accel_dev)
{
	struct pci_dev *pdev = accel_to_pci_dev(accel_dev);
	struct pci_dev *parent = pdev->bus->self;
	uint16_t ppdstat = 0, bridge_ctl = 0;
	int pending = 0;

	pr_info("QAT: Resetting device qat_dev%d\n", accel_dev->accel_id);
	pci_read_config_word(pdev, PPDSTAT_OFFSET, &ppdstat);
	pending = ppdstat & PCI_EXP_DEVSTA_TRPND;
	if (pending) {
		int ctr = 0;

		do {
			msleep(100);
			pci_read_config_word(pdev, PPDSTAT_OFFSET, &ppdstat);
			pending = ppdstat & PCI_EXP_DEVSTA_TRPND;
		} while (pending && ctr++ < 10);
	}

	if (pending)
		pr_info("QAT: Transaction still in progress. Proceeding\n");

	pci_read_config_word(parent, PCI_BRIDGE_CONTROL, &bridge_ctl);
	bridge_ctl |= PCI_BRIDGE_CTL_BUS_RESET;
	pci_write_config_word(parent, PCI_BRIDGE_CONTROL, bridge_ctl);
	msleep(100);
	bridge_ctl &= ~PCI_BRIDGE_CTL_BUS_RESET;
	pci_write_config_word(parent, PCI_BRIDGE_CONTROL, bridge_ctl);
	msleep(100);
	pci_restore_state(pdev);
	pci_save_state(pdev);
}

/**
 * adf_enable_aer() - Enable Advance Error Reporting for acceleration device
 * @accel_dev:  Pointer to acceleration device.
 * @adf:        PCI device driver owning the given acceleration device.
 *
 * Function enables PCI Advance Error Reporting for the
 * QAT acceleration device accel_dev.
 * To be used by QAT device specific drivers.
 *
 * Return: 0 on success, error code othewise.
 */
int adf_enable_aer(struct adf_accel_dev *accel_dev, struct pci_driver *adf)
{
	struct pci_dev *pdev = accel_to_pci_dev(accel_dev);

	adf->err_handler = &adf_err_handler;
	pci_enable_pcie_error_reporting(pdev);
	return 0;
}

static int adf_request_msi_irq(struct adf_accel_dev *accel_dev)
{
	struct pci_dev *pdev = accel_to_pci_dev(accel_dev);
	unsigned int cpu;
	int ret;

	snprintf(accel_dev->vf.irq_name, ADF_MAX_MSIX_VECTOR_NAME,
		 "qat_%02x:%02d.%02d", pdev->bus->number, PCI_SLOT(pdev->devfn),
		 PCI_FUNC(pdev->devfn));
	ret = request_irq(pdev->irq, adf_isr, 0, accel_dev->vf.irq_name,
			  (void *)accel_dev);
	if (ret) {
		dev_err(&GET_DEV(accel_dev), "failed to enable irq for %s\n",
			accel_dev->vf.irq_name);
		return ret;
	}
	cpu = accel_dev->accel_id % num_online_cpus();
	irq_set_affinity_hint(pdev->irq, get_cpu_mask(cpu));

	return ret;
}

void adf_reset_sbr(struct adf_accel_dev *accel_dev)
{
	struct pci_dev *pdev = accel_to_pci_dev(accel_dev);
	struct pci_dev *parent = pdev->bus->self;
	uint16_t bridge_ctl = 0;

	if (!parent)
		parent = pdev;

	if (!pci_wait_for_pending_transaction(pdev))
		dev_info(&GET_DEV(accel_dev),
			 "Transaction still in progress. Proceeding\n");

	dev_info(&GET_DEV(accel_dev), "Secondary bus reset\n");

	pci_read_config_word(parent, PCI_BRIDGE_CONTROL, &bridge_ctl);
	bridge_ctl |= PCI_BRIDGE_CTL_BUS_RESET;
	pci_write_config_word(parent, PCI_BRIDGE_CONTROL, bridge_ctl);
	msleep(100);
	bridge_ctl &= ~PCI_BRIDGE_CTL_BUS_RESET;
	pci_write_config_word(parent, PCI_BRIDGE_CONTROL, bridge_ctl);
	msleep(100);
}
